Planning Your Visit

Timed Entry Reservations

Many popular areas, including the Going-to-the-Sun Road, require timed entry vehicle reservations during peak season. Book these well in advance online to avoid disappointment. TikTok

Wildlife Safety

Glacier National Park is home to bears and mountain goats. Always carry bear spray and know how to use it. Maintain a safe distance from all wildlife. TikTokReddit

For Different Travelers

Tailored advice for your travel style

👨‍👩‍👧 Families with Kids

Glacier National Park offers fantastic experiences for families. The Lake McDonald area is great for easy exploration, with opportunities to skip colorful rocks and enjoy gentle walks. The park shuttle system can be a fun and convenient way for kids to see the sights without the stress of parking. TikTok

For families with older children, consider shorter, well-maintained hikes like the Trail of the Cedars or parts of the Hidden Lake Trail. Always pack plenty of snacks and water, and be prepared for changing weather. Wildlife sightings, like mountain goats or bighorn sheep, are always a hit with kids! TikTokReddit

🚗 Road Trippers

The Going-to-the-Sun Road is the ultimate road trip experience in Glacier National Park. This iconic drive offers breathtaking views at every turn, making it a must-do for any road trip itinerary. Remember to secure your timed entry reservation well in advance, as this is crucial for accessing the road during peak season. TikTok+1

Plan for frequent stops at pull-offs to soak in the scenery and take photos. Consider downloading offline maps as cell service can be spotty. Pack a picnic to enjoy at one of the scenic spots, and be prepared for winding roads and potential delays due to wildlife or construction. TikTok

🥾 Avid Hikers

Glacier National Park is a hiker's paradise, offering a vast network of trails for all skill levels. For a challenging but incredibly rewarding experience, the hike to Scenic Point in Two Medicine is highly recommended for its stunning vistas and wildlife potential. Reddit The Highline Trail is another epic option, offering dramatic alpine scenery. TikTok

Be sure to carry bear spray, wear appropriate footwear, and check trail conditions before heading out. Many higher-elevation trails may still have snow well into the summer. Consider bringing hiking poles for added stability, especially on steep or uneven terrain. Reddit

Driving the Going-to-the-Sun Road

The Going-to-the-Sun Road is the crown jewel of Glacier National Park, offering an unforgettable scenic drive. This engineering marvel traverses the park from east to west, ascending through diverse ecosystems from lush valleys to alpine tundra. The road is typically open from late June to mid-October, weather permitting. Due to its popularity, timed entry vehicle reservations are required during peak season, so plan ahead and book yours online. TikTok+1

Along the route, you'll encounter numerous pull-offs and viewpoints, each offering a unique perspective of the park's grandeur. Key stops include Lake McDonald, Logan Pass (the highest point on the road), and the Weeping Wall. Be prepared for winding roads, steep drop-offs, and potential wildlife sightings. It's advisable to start your drive early in the morning to avoid crowds and increase your chances of seeing wildlife. TikTok+1

Remember to check the park's official website for current road status, closures, and reservation requirements before your visit. The drive itself can take several hours, especially with stops, so allocate ample time to truly savor the experience. TikTok

Hiking and Wildlife Encounters

Glacier National Park is a hiker's paradise, with trails ranging from easy strolls to challenging backcountry treks. The Hidden Lake Trail from Logan Pass is a classic, leading to a stunning alpine lake and often providing close encounters with mountain goats. For a more strenuous but highly rewarding experience, the hike to Scenic Point in the Two Medicine area offers panoramic views and a good chance of spotting bighorn sheep and other wildlife. TikTokReddit

When hiking, always carry bear spray and know how to use it. The park is home to both grizzly and black bears. Stick to marked trails, make noise to avoid surprising animals, and never feed wildlife. Other common sightings include mountain goats, bighorn sheep, elk, and deer. Early morning and late afternoon are generally the best times for wildlife viewing. TikTokReddit

Be prepared for varying trail conditions, including snow patches well into summer at higher elevations. Hiking poles can be very helpful, especially on steeper or snow-covered sections. Always check trail conditions before you go and be aware of your surroundings. Reddit

Photography Opportunities

Glacier National Park is a photographer's dream, offering endless opportunities to capture its dramatic landscapes and abundant wildlife. Lake McDonald is particularly famous for its colorful, smooth rocks that create a vibrant foreground against the clear water and surrounding mountains. The Going-to-the-Sun Road provides countless scenic overlooks perfect for wide-angle shots of valleys, glaciers, and peaks. TikTok+1

For wildlife photography, patience is key. Use a telephoto lens to capture animals like mountain goats and bighorn sheep from a safe distance. Early morning and late evening light, known as the 'golden hour,' offers the most flattering and dramatic illumination for both landscapes and wildlife. Consider visiting spots like Wild Goose Island Overlook for iconic shots. TikTok+1

Remember that drone photography is prohibited within the park. Always respect wildlife and maintain a safe distance to avoid disturbing them. TikTok
